Transaction 21fe0c13abe23f12b15191d1207aebc63fc80da38eb666655ad339d63592c142
1 Input
1 Output
-
21fe0c13abe23f12b15191d1207aebc63fc80da38eb666655ad339d63592c142:0
- value
- 20624
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 285d262f214b6d123d99411714cbdc637a09555f2a1e42136121c24beaa7b6a2
- address
- bc1p9pwjvtepfdk3y0vegyt3fj7uvdaqj42l9g0yyympy8pyh648k63qx3elkk